Overview

In the heart of Rock Hill, South Carolina, Fountain Park draws people together, its spray of cool water rising against a backdrop that marries fresh urban design with long‑loved local traditions.

The park, which opened in 2014, was built as part of Rock Hill’s push to breathe new life into its historic downtown, giving families, locals, and visitors a friendly spot to meet, unwind on the grass, and enjoy community events.

History and DevelopmentWhat used to be a broad expanse of cracked asphalt for parking is now a leafy public green space, created by city leaders to bring more life and comfort to the heart of downtown.

Public-private partnerships fueled the project, as the City of Rock Hill and local businesses saw the need for a central civic space—somewhere neighbors could meet under the old oak in the square.

Since it opened, the park has anchored Rock Hill’s push to revive downtown, drawing people to its shaded benches and lively weekend events.

At the heart of it all stands a sweeping, 100‑foot‑wide fountain that dances with light and water—one of the biggest you’ll find anywhere in the Carolinas.

At night, the fountain bursts into life—jets of water leap as high as 100 feet, glowing in shifting shades from color-changing LED lights.

The design lets kids splash in the cool water on hot days, turning it into something that’s both fun to use and nice to look at.

The park’s green lawns stretch wide, with benches tucked under cool, leafy shade—an inviting spot to sit back and relax.

Paved walkways lead from the fountain to the nearby downtown streets, making it easy for people to stroll over as the sound of water fades behind them.

There’s a small stage tucked in the corner, ready for community events, live performances, and casual get‑togethers.

Fountain Park stays lively all year, hosting concerts that fill the air with music, bustling farmers markets, colorful festivals, holiday gatherings, and vibrant cultural events.

It’s been home to Rock Hill favorites—from the twinkle-lit ChristmasVille celebrations to warm summer movie nights and the energy of live music echoing through the air.
